Formation of Very Large Conductance Channels by Bacillus cereus Nhe in Vero and GH(4) Cells Identifies NheA + B as the Inherent Pore-Forming Structure
The nonhemolytic enterotoxin (Nhe) produced by Bacillus cereus is a pore-forming toxin consisting of three components, NheA, -B and -C.
